MENTAL is a feature-length documentary that observes the complex world of an outpatient mental health clinic in Japan, interwoven with patients, doctors, staff, volunteers, and home-helpers, in cinema- verite style. The film breaks a major taboo against discussing mental illness prevalent in Japanese society, and captures the candid lives of people coping with suicidal tendencies, poverty, a sense of shame, apprehension, and fear of society.

One out of ten in Denmark suffers from mental illness and it is the most common health condition of them all. Yet, due to the taboo and stigmatisation of mental illness, it is still under prioritized and as a result the welfare system is pushed to its limits. The care of the mentally ill instead falls upon relatives, most often parents and they become the lifeline and primary carer. When a family member gets sick it affects everyone in that family and especially those who love them. LOVE BOUND unconvers the unconditional love, which governs the relationship most parents have to their children and that must somehow be altered, when a child is suffering from mental illness.
